What Is Infrastructure Monitoring?
Infrastructure monitoring is the process of continuously tracking the performance, health, and availability of IT systems. Monitoring tools collect data from servers, network devices, applications, and cloud platforms to detect issues early.
Monitoring platforms typically track metrics such as:
- CPU and memory usage
- Network traffic and latency
- Server uptime
- Storage capacity
- Application performance
- Security alerts
When abnormal activity is detected, alerts notify IT teams so they can respond quickly before problems escalate into outages.

What Is Infrastructure Management?
Infrastructure management goes beyond monitoring. It includes the processes, tools, and strategies used to maintain, secure, and optimize the systems that support business operations.
Infrastructure management includes activities such as:
- Server configuration and maintenance
- Network optimization
- Security updates and patch management
- Hardware lifecycle planning
- Backup and disaster recovery
- Infrastructure scaling and upgrades
While monitoring helps identify problems, management ensures those problems are resolved and systems continue operating efficiently.

How Monitoring and Management Work Together
Monitoring and management are closely connected. Monitoring tools detect problems, while infrastructure management processes address those problems.
For example:
- Monitoring detects a server running out of storage
- Infrastructure management expands storage capacity
- Monitoring identifies abnormal network traffic
- Security management investigates the potential threat
Without monitoring, IT teams may not discover issues until systems fail. Without management, detected issues remain unresolved.

Infrastructure Monitoring vs Infrastructure Management: Key Differences
| Infrastructure Monitoring | Infrastructure Management |
|---|---|
| Tracks system performance | Maintains and optimizes systems |
| Detects potential problems | Resolves issues and prevents failures |
| Provides alerts and data | Implements solutions and improvements |
| Focuses on observation | Focuses on action and strategy |
